Tolls and E-ZPass

photo of George Washington Bridge toll collector

The toll is paid heading into New York. Westbound to New Jersey is always free. Some restrictions apply.

Truck & Traffic Restrictions

photo of George Washington Bridge traffic

Trucks and RVs must use the upper level. There are a number of traffic restrictions.
